Around 20,000 domestic and foreign tourists visited Wakatobi district, Southeast Sulawesi Province, during 2010. “The number of tourist arrivals this year significantly increases, from only 5,000 in the previous year,” Wakatobi District Head Hugua said here Friday. The number of foreign tourists in Jakarta increased 22.16 percent in October to 158,469 visits from 130,542 visits in the previous months, based on the record from three entry points: Soekarno-Hatta International Airport, Halim Perdanakusumah Airport and Tanjungpriok Airport.
